### Step 4: Migrate BranchReaper settings

Before enabling BranchReaper 2.x on the Holtby repositories, you must carry over the cleanup thresholds from the legacy bot, as the new version does not read the old settings file. Verify each value carefully — an incorrect staleness window can delete active contractor branches. After backing up the old file, apply the configuration shown below.

service settings:
[silwyn]
host = silwyn.crelvogrid.internal
user = silwyn_svc
database = silwyn_prod

Subject: Pilot with Hartleby Stores — update

Team: Pilot of the Quillon checkout platform at six Hartleby locations starts Monday. Metrics: basket size, queue time, staff feedback. Weekly readouts from Mara Teel. No press, no external mentions until Hartleby signs the joint statement. Expansion decision at week eight. Budget stays within the approved envelope. For full context, see the confidential business note appended below.

management briefing: The renewal with Zoraelax Group closes at $10 million a year, 15 percent below the last contract. Project Ralael slips by six weeks because of the audit delay.

Checklist item 4: Metron sidecar rollout. Confirm scrape interval is 15s, not 5s — the old default overloads small nodes. Check that counter resets no longer appear as negative spikes in the Fennick dashboard. If customers report gaps, the cause is usually the sidecar restarting faster than its flush window; tell them to wait one interval before escalating. Tova has the rollback script staged. Canary runs Tuesday, fleet-wide Thursday. All support tickets should reference the build token given below.

pipeline stamp: htk31_f769b577b3028a4e9958e5bb8d1259a

**CI note: GC pauses in MatchGrove service tests**

Integration tests for MatchGrove occasionally time out due to long garbage-collection pauses under the default heap settings. If you see a timeout with no error, check the GC log artifact before retrying. The fix (tuned pause target) landed last week; older branches still need a rebase. Failures should be reported with the run's trace token, noted below.

build token for kagaf-hahof: htk14_9d3d4d26d7d8de